Strathmore University unveils course to help curb cyber crime

NAIROBI: Strathmore University has launched a Master of Science Information Systems Security course, the most advanced training available for information security experts in the region. The programme is in response to the growing need of cyber security in the country.

Speaking when he launched the course at the university, ICT Cabinet Secretary Fred Matiang’i said cyber threats had heightened with the migration of Government data and essential services to digital platforms.
